Transaction 16db08fed39d4fcfe50da6399e75ee3cc45728a763ba45bde4cdb005c8cce6dc

7 Input
2 Outputs
  • 16db08fed39d4fcfe50da6399e75ee3cc45728a763ba45bde4cdb005c8cce6dc:0
  • value  68227
    address  3DtuU2cw9TNPDsASYzN7JX7EwwKnuZvxrR
  • 16db08fed39d4fcfe50da6399e75ee3cc45728a763ba45bde4cdb005c8cce6dc:1
  • value  5125113
    address  3QWMNmFv35RryCeRXYmdyrL2t6vfeP4MAN